Shopify (Best for Selling Merch & Digital Products)
👉 Affiliate Link: Shopify
“I want to sell merch, but I don’t have a huge budget for inventory.”
If selling merchandise, music, or digital products is your primary focus, Shopify is best website builder for an artists e-commerce platform. Shopify is built specifically for online stores, unlike other website builders, making it perfect for indie musicians, painters, and designers.

Key Benefits for Artists:
✅ Sell anything—vinyl, digital downloads, art prints, apparel & more
✅ Easy integrations with Instagram, TikTok, YouTube, and Facebook
✅ Dropshipping & print-on-demand options are available (so no upfront inventory costs)
✅ Powerful analytics & marketing tools to increase sales
💡 Best For: Artists focused on monetizing their work and growing their merch business.
